Registering a Clinical Trial Application in Japan Comprehensive Guide to Registering a Clinical Trial Application in Japan Step 1: Understand the Regulatory Environment Before embarking on the registration of a Clinical Trial Application (CTA) in Japan, it is crucial to familiarize yourself with the regulatory environment governing clinical trials. The Pharmaceuticals and Medical Devices Agency (PMDA) is the primary regulatory body overseeing clinical trials in Japan, ensuring compliance with the Pharmaceuticals and Medical Devices Act (PMD Act). Submitting ICH Q8 Document Preparation, Step-by-Step Regulatory Tutorial Guide for Preparing ICH Q8 Documents: A Step-by-Step Approach Understanding the ICH Q8 Guidelines The International Council for Harmonisation of Technical Requirements for Pharmaceuticals for Human Use (ICH) established the Q8 guidelines to facilitate the development and manufacture of pharmaceuticals while ensuring product quality and consistency. ICH Q8 centers on the concept of quality by design (QbD), which emphasizes the proactive identification and control of critical quality attributes throughout the product’s lifecycle. Preparing a DMF with US FDA Step-by-Step Guide to Preparing a Drug Master File for Submission to the FDA Preparing a Drug Master File (DMF) for submission to the US Food and Drug Administration (FDA) is a critical process for pharmaceutical companies seeking compliance and approval for their drug substances and products. A DMF serves as a confidential document that provides detailed information about facilities, manufacturing processes, and packaging.
